The Ultimate Guide to Rude Slang: Definitions and Examples

Rude slang represents a fascinating and often volatile corner of language, serving as the sharp edge of everyday communication. These words and phrases carry a unique power, capable of shocking, bonding, or offending depending on context and audience. Understanding this lexicon is about more than just knowing taboo words; it is about decoding a specific social signal that instantly marks a boundary as crossed or a relationship as intimate.

The Social Function of Vulgarity

At its core, rude slang functions as a tool for social navigation, operating on the principle of taboo. The shock value inherent in these words gives them an immediacy that polite language often lacks, making them effective for expressing raw emotion or establishing in-group identity. When used among friends, such language can be a sign of comfort and shared humor, a way to diffuse tension through laughter. Conversely, when deployed in professional or unfamiliar settings, the same words act as a social grenade, instantly creating distance and signaling a breach of accepted norms.

Context is King

The meaning of a vulgar term is entirely dependent on the frame in which it is delivered. A phrase muttered under your breath after stubbing your toe carries a completely different weight than the same phrase shouted during a heated argument. Tone, relationship hierarchy, and cultural background act as filters, transforming a word from a genuine expression of frustration into a playful jab or an unforgivable insult. This contextual fluidity is what makes the language so potent and simultaneously difficult to master for outsiders.

The Generational and Cultural Divide

Language evolves, and rude slang is perhaps the fastest-moving target in the linguistic world. What was considered shocking a generation ago may now be a mild expletive in daily conversation, pushed further into obscurity by the next wave of speakers. Furthermore, regional variations mean that a vulgar term harmless in one city can be deeply offensive in another. This constant churn means that understanding the "rules" of rude slang requires staying attuned to the specific subculture, whether that is a local dialect, an online community, or a particular age demographic.

The Digital Acceleration

The rise of social media and instant messaging has dramatically altered the trajectory of rude slang. Words that once spread through local dialects or subcultures can now achieve global prominence in a matter of days. Screens provide a layer of anonymity that encourages the use of harsher language than might be used in person, leading to a coarsening of public discourse. However, this same environment allows for rapid semantic shift, where words lose their sting as they are adopted ironically or used for comedic effect.
